cpp学习
MapzChen
程序员
展开
-
vs下二进制读取文本文件到buffer中结尾出现乱码的解决
#include #include #include using namespace std; int main(){ ifstream fileIn; char* buff; long size; fileIn.open("testIO.cpp",ios::binary|ios::in|ios::ate|ios::_Nocreate); if(!fileIn){ cout原创 2012-12-29 11:36:53 · 1185 阅读 · 0 评论 -
C/C++的预编译宏做成代码模版使用
#define SHOW_VEC(_type,_vec,_it)\ vector::iterator _it = _vec.begin();\ while(_it!=_vec.end()){\ cout << *_it++ << endl;\ } 我们经常有时候会想要遍历输出一个容器里面的每个元素, 一般来说我们通常想到的是函数模板泛型来实现不通类的容器的遍历输出, 但就算实现了该原创 2012-12-29 16:37:54 · 855 阅读 · 0 评论